The Importance Of Carbon Strategies For A Sustainable Future
In recent years, the issue of carbon emissions and their impact on the environment has come to the forefront of global discussions. The burning of fossil fuels and other human activities have led to an increase in carbon dioxide and other greenhouse gases in the atmosphere, which has contributed to climate change and its severe consequences. It is crucial for companies, governments, and individuals to adopt carbon strategies to reduce their carbon footprint and mitigate the effects of climate change.
carbon strategies encompass a wide range of actions and initiatives aimed at reducing carbon emissions and promoting sustainability. These strategies can include investing in renewable energy sources such as solar, wind, and hydroelectric power, improving energy efficiency in buildings and transportation, implementing carbon pricing mechanisms, and supporting reforestation and other nature-based solutions. By implementing these strategies, organizations can reduce their environmental impact, save costs, enhance their reputation, and contribute to a more sustainable future for all.
One of the most effective carbon strategies that organizations can adopt is to transition to renewable energy sources. Fossil fuels such as coal, oil, and natural gas are major sources of carbon emissions, and transitioning to cleaner sources of energy can significantly reduce an organization’s carbon footprint. Solar, wind, and hydroelectric power are all renewable energy sources that produce electricity without emitting greenhouse gases. By investing in these technologies and integrating them into their operations, companies can reduce their reliance on fossil fuels and help mitigate climate change.
Improving energy efficiency is another important carbon strategy that organizations can implement. By optimizing energy use in buildings, vehicles, and industrial processes, companies can reduce their energy consumption and lower their carbon emissions. This can be achieved through measures such as installing energy-efficient lighting and appliances, insulating buildings to reduce heating and cooling costs, and optimizing production processes to minimize waste and energy consumption. Improving energy efficiency not only helps companies reduce their environmental impact but also saves costs and improves overall operational efficiency.
Implementing carbon pricing mechanisms is another effective carbon strategy that governments can adopt to incentivize companies to reduce their carbon emissions. Carbon pricing involves putting a price on carbon emissions, either through a carbon tax or a cap-and-trade system, which creates a financial incentive for companies to reduce their carbon footprint. By internalizing the cost of carbon emissions, companies are motivated to invest in cleaner technologies and practices that reduce their emissions and comply with regulatory requirements. Carbon pricing can also generate revenue that can be reinvested in renewable energy projects and other sustainability initiatives.
Supporting reforestation and other nature-based solutions is also a crucial carbon strategy that organizations can adopt to offset their carbon emissions and promote biodiversity. Forests and other natural ecosystems act as carbon sinks, absorbing carbon dioxide from the atmosphere and storing it in plants and soil. By investing in reforestation projects and protecting existing forests, companies can help sequester carbon dioxide and mitigate the effects of climate change. Nature-based solutions such as wetland restoration, sustainable agriculture, and habitat conservation can also contribute to carbon sequestration and enhance ecosystem resilience in the face of climate change.
